Variables Influencing Roof Expenses
When you're thinking about a new roof covering, numerous factors can affect the total cost. Initially, the dimension of your roofing plays a critical duty. Bigger roofings call for more products and labor, driving up costs.
Next off, the complexity of your roofing's layout issues. If your roof has several inclines, valleys, or one-of-a-kind functions, installation can come to be extra difficult and costly.
Labor expenses also differ based on your location and the availability of skilled workers. Areas with greater need for roof solutions often see boosted labor prices.
Additionally, the timing of your job can impact prices, as roofing business may provide lower rates throughout the offseason.
One more vital factor is the problem of your existing roofing system. If you need to get rid of old products or make repair work before setting up a new roof, those included tasks will boost your total budget plan.
Finally, your option of roofing system can affect expenses, as some alternatives might call for specific setup techniques.
Understanding these factors assists you get ready for the economic dedication of a new roofing. By being informed, you can make better decisions that line up with your budget and long-lasting goals for your home.
Kinds Of Roofing Products
Picking the ideal roof material is essential for both the aesthetics and longevity of your home. You've obtained a number of options, each with its very own benefits and drawbacks.
Asphalt roof shingles are the most popular selection because of their price and very easy setup. They can be found in numerous colors and designs, making it easy to match your home's exterior.

If you're looking for a more green selection, think about shingles made from recycled products or even an eco-friendly roof with living plants.
Clay and concrete tiles offer an unique, timeless look that boosts visual appeal. Nevertheless, they can be heavy and may call for additional structural support.
If you like a special appearance, slate roof covering supplies a lavish coating but can be fairly pricey and tough to set up.
Eventually, your option must reflect your spending plan, climate, and personal design. Take your time to evaluate the benefits and drawbacks before making a decision.
Recognizing Labor Expenses
Labor costs can substantially influence the total expense of your roof covering job. When you employ a specialist, you're not simply paying for their time; you're also covering their experience and the skills of their team. Different aspects influence labor costs. The complexity of your roof plays a big role-- steeper roofings or those with multiple aspects need even more ability and time, causing greater labor expenses.
Geographical location matters as well; professionals in urban areas commonly charge extra because of higher demand and living costs.
It's additionally important to consider the service provider's experience and track record. While you might discover less costly alternatives, choosing a trustworthy specialist can save you money in the long run by reducing the threat of errors and making sure quality craftsmanship.
When you obtain estimates, ensure to break down the prices to see how much is designated for labor. This way, you'll have a more clear picture and can spending plan accordingly, ensuring your roof covering task remains on track monetarily.
